This is part of a bigger problem, I need to find an expression in terms of θ for the expression below.


1. x=(2r sin⁡θ)/3θ where x=r/2
2. r/2=(2r sin⁡θ)/3θ
3. r=(4r sin⁡θ)/3θ
4. 1=(4 sin⁡θ)/3θ
5. 1/4= sin⁡θ/3θ
6. 3θ/4= sin^-1(θ)

I don't know where to go from there. All I need is an expression in the form of θ= ...
